108409-93-4,106663-54-1,1086685-29-1,848444-69-9,848444-79-1,848445-02-3 Supplier | CHEMROOTS.COM
CMO CDMO service. CHEMROOTS.COM supply 108409-93-4,106663-54-1,1086685-29-1,848444-69-9,848444-79-1,848445-02-3 and related compounds.
108409-93-4 106663-54-1 848444-69-9 848445-02-3 848444-79-1 1086685-29-1